Baysour Celebrates Nature: Eco-Hiking Event on the Hima Trail

In an atmosphere full of energy and community spirit, Baysour Hiking Group, in collaboration with The Progressive Youth Organization – Baysour Cell, organized a special eco-sports event along the Hima Trail in Baysour, one of the village’s most scenic natural landmarks. The event welcomed hiking enthusiasts of all ages to experience an exceptional journey through the stunning landscapes and forests of Baysour.

Minister Ghazi Aridi Joins the Walk

The event was marked by the distinguished participation of Minister Ghazi Aridi, a long-time supporter of environmental and development initiatives in Baysour and the surrounding region. His presence was both inspiring and symbolic, as he joined participants along the Hima Trail, emphasizing the importance of preserving the Hima, promoting eco-tourism, and adopting sustainable development practices in Lebanese villages.

The Hima Trail: Where Nature and Community Meet

The hike began early in the morning along the recently restored trail, rehabilitated through a joint effort with the Society for the Protection of Nature in Lebanon (SPNL). This initiative is part of ongoing efforts to protect biodiversity, raise environmental awareness, and engage local communities in safeguarding their natural resources.

The trail forms part of the broader Baysour Hima, a community-based conservation area aimed at involving residents, especially youth, in nature protection, while promoting outdoor education, eco-tourism, and sustainable rural development.

في هذا العدد من مجلة الحمى، ننسج معًا قصصًا ملهمة عن حماية الطبيعة وصمود المجتمعات، مسلطين الضوء على كيف يُعاد ترميم لبنان... حمى تلو الأخرى. تواصل جمعية حماية الطبيعة في لبنان (SPNL) مهمتها في الحفاظ على التراث الطبيعي للبلاد من خلال تمكين المجتمعات المحلية. ومن الركائز الأساسية لهذا الجهد مشروع BioConnect المموّل من الاتحاد الأوروبي، والذي حقق ثلاث سوابق وطنية: أول منتزه طبيعي في لبنان (المتن الأعلى)، وأول منتزه جيولوجي (الشوف – جزين)، وأول حمى وقفية (بتخنيه).
